1 Stage, 1 City, 1 Week: Chanel Brings Together 5 NYC Dance Companies for the BAAND Together Festival

Being in Europe for the summer is undeniably chic, but nothing compares to New York City during the warm-weather season. The energy is unmatched—there’s always something to do, somewhere to explore, and a new reason to fall in love with it.

Whether you live in or are visiting NYC, one happening that deserves a spot on your calendar is the BAAND Together Dance Festival. This event brings together five of the city’s premier dance companies: Ballet Hispánico, Alvin Ailey American Dance Theater, American Ballet Theatre, New York City Ballet, and Dance Theatre of Harlem. Together, this group will showcase a series of performances through a variety of dance forms from July 28 to August 1 at the David H. Koch Theater as part of Lincoln Center’s Summer for the City series. And it’s all made possible by the one and only Chanel.

While Chanel and dance might not seem like an obvious combination, the brand actually has an enduring relationship with the art form. Among Gabrielle Chanel’s core inspirations was flexibility of movement—an influence she expressed throughout all her creations, including her collaborations with legendary choreographers during her lifetime. So, Chanel’s support and partnership with the BAAND Together Dance Festival since its inception in 2021 is very meaningful. It highlights the brand’s long-standing connection to and patronage within the world of dance, a legacy that has continued for over a century.
